The Narrow Case for Speed
Driving faster than posted limits does offer one concrete benefit: reduced travel time. On a 60-mile highway stretch, traveling at 80 mph instead of 65 mph saves roughly 8 minutes. For professional drivers with tight delivery schedules or anyone facing a genuine time emergency, that margin can feel meaningful.
Beyond raw time savings, some drivers argue that maintaining higher speeds on multi-lane interstates improves traffic flow when roads are lightly traveled. In limited circumstances — such as passing safely on a two-lane road — briefly exceeding the limit may reduce the time spent in oncoming-traffic exposure.

These benefits are real but narrow. They apply mainly to specific road types, low-traffic conditions, and short windows of time. For most everyday commutes and errands, the time saved is negligible against the costs outlined below.
The Financial Toll of Driving Too Fast
A speeding ticket is just the opening charge. Base fines vary widely by state and how far over the limit a driver was traveling, but court costs, processing fees, and mandatory surcharges routinely double or triple the face amount of the citation.

The longer-term hit comes from insurance. Insurers treat a speeding conviction as evidence of elevated risk and typically raise premiums at the next renewal. Depending on your insurer and state, a single ticket can increase annual premiums by a meaningful percentage — and most insurers track violations for three to five years, meaning the surcharge compounds across multiple renewals.
Fuel economy suffers too. Aerodynamic drag increases exponentially with speed: the energy required to push a vehicle through air roughly quadruples when speed doubles. Most vehicles achieve their best fuel economy between 45 and 60 mph; fuel efficiency typically drops noticeably above 70 mph. Over tens of thousands of miles driven each year, that adds up at the pump. For a fuller picture of annual ownership costs, see the real cost of owning a car.
Speeding also accelerates mechanical wear. Brakes, tires, and suspension components all experience greater stress at higher speeds. Deferred maintenance compounds these costs when wear goes unaddressed.

The Safety Reality
Speed is a leading factor in traffic fatalities in the United States, according to the National Highway Traffic Safety Administration. At higher speeds, stopping distances increase sharply — a vehicle traveling at 70 mph needs significantly more road to stop than one traveling at 55 mph — and the forces involved in a crash escalate with the square of the speed change.
Reaction time is fixed. Whether a child steps into the road or a car brakes suddenly ahead, a driver's cognitive and physical response takes roughly the same fraction of a second regardless of how fast they're going. At higher speeds, the distance covered during that reaction window is much greater, leaving less margin to avoid a collision.

Speed Limits Reflect Road Design, Not Just Law
Posted speed limits are set based on road geometry, sight-line distances, pedestrian activity, and crash history — not arbitrarily. Driving at or below the limit is specifically calibrated to give the average driver enough stopping and reaction distance for that road's conditions. Wet, icy, or congested roads often call for speeds well below the posted limit even when following the law technically. Adjust speed to actual conditions, not just the sign.
